Winter Hiking
and Snowshoeing
The hills and
mountains in the Ludlow area are laced
with hiking trails. Many of them also offer splendid
snowshoeing opportunities. Some trails may not be
obvious, but information is easy to get.
The Green Mountain
Club, which built and maintains Vermont’s famed Long Trail from Massachusetts to
Canada, publishes guides to
both short and long hikes in the area, as well as a
snowshoeing guide for
Vermont. The
club’s local chapters (called “sections,” because each keeps
up a section of the Long Trail) also schedule frequent
outings with experienced leaders. Virtually all are
free, and many are open to non-members.
